EEF appoints chief strategy and corporate development officer

1 min read

A new chief strategy and corporate development officer has been appointed at EEF, the manufacturers’ organisation.

Mark Bernard (pictured) will take on the role in May and lead the organisation’s long-term growth programme and membership development activity.

He will also co-ordinate EEF’s strategic marketing activity and oversee the introduction of new technologies to support services and member engagement.

Says Bernard: “I’m thrilled to be joining EEF as it invests in an exciting transformation programme. Manufacturing is key to Britain’s success and EEF’s members will continue to benefit from the strength of its services and representational work.”

Bernard is former group marketing director of BM Polyco and played a leading role in transforming BM Polyco’s business model. He has also held senior commercial marketing roles with Polaroid, Casio, LG and Stanley Black & Decker.

Says Terry Scuoler, chief executive of EEF: “Mark brings considerable experience of business transformation and his strategic marketing pedigree will support our modernisation programme and digital investments to better support member companies and grow and strengthen our business services.”
